Digging conditions in Juneau County

Alaska winters bring frost to roughly 72" of depth around Juneau, so cold-weather digs here often favor air excavation or heated-water hydrovac to work frozen ground. Juneau sits in a cold subarctic climate, which sets the seasonal window for excavation here. Ground around Juneau runs to clay, loam and sandy loam, which shapes how quickly water- or air-based excavation cuts and how the spoil is handled. Before you dig in Juneau

Before any excavation in Juneau, the law requires marking buried utilities through Alaska Dig Line. Contact them at 811 ahead of digging. Alaska requires minimum 2 business days notice before excavation. Service providers booked through Vac Hotline handle locates as part of a properly run job.

Which type of vacuum truck do I need for my job in Juneau?

It depends on the work: hydrovac and air vacuum trucks dig safely around utilities, combo trucks clean sewers and pipes, and liquid or liquid-ring units recover fluids and slurry. Describe your Juneau job and we match it to service providers with the right equipment.
